Transaction 3efab0741d52e9e17ca41322f9726918666cb34b7b2a29cc1e273dffb8e41cfd

block
6795c342fb92f8a0621a3c01db976cbad1f9a7da1e2bbebc3633410a0aed12d4

1 Input

30 Outputs